Hi guys,
I am going to create the worlds best 1:18 scale model of a 1969 Dodge Charger. I admire high quality and exceptional detailing in scale models and that usually results in me being unsatisfied with production versions of scale models. I hate imperfection of plastic components.
My past work experience
1] Tool room (designing plastic,rubber & sheet metal dies and molds.)
2] Machine tool builder (including hand scraping machine bed)
3] Machinist
4] CAD user for 8 yrs.
5] CNC 3d engraving machine (currently building one)
The body of the car I plan to make from sheet metal forming, just like they do for a 1:1 car.
Thanks.
